December 22, 2011 – The Standard Catalog of World Coins 1601-1700 is now available from Krause Publications. Edited by George Cuhaj and Tom Michael, this fifth edition presents some of the fastest-rising retail values for world coins. Economic factors have continued to drive collector interest and push prices for these classic coins higher and higher.

Tom Michael & George Cuhaj (ed.), Standard Catalog of World Coins 1601-1700. Krause Publishing, 5th edition, 1560 pages, 22,500 b/w illustrations. ISBN 9781440217043. Paperback. $85.00.

The fifth edition Standard Catalog of World Coins 1601-1700 features:

– Updated values for all coin listings
– Substantial changes in value for most European coinage
– Additional listings and value changes for German states
– Expanded listings for Italian states and the Netherlands
– Complete revisions for India, Iran and Iraq
– Full value updates for Austria, Hungary and Transylvania
– Special auction quotes for many rare coinage types

With information compiled by over 200 experts worldwide, this book features collector coins, sets, trial strikes, patterns, token issues, etc. with nearly 300,000 accurate coin prices in up to 5 grades and 22,500 quality images including hundreds of improved images for easy identification.
